Adjective: cast-iron ,kãst'I(-u)rnNoun: cast iron kãst I(-u)rn
- An alloy of iron containing so much carbon that it is brittle and so cannot be wrought but must be shaped by casting
"The antique skillet was made of heavy cast iron"
